After being appointed as border tsar of President Trump, Tom Homan was recorded in September 2024, supposedly, a bag with $ 50,000 in cash in an undercover FBI investigationHowever, the case was closed by officials of the Republican Administration.
According to The Washington Post, two sources close to the case and a document belonging to the research cited by the newspaper, Homan was recorded receiving cash in a meeting in Texas in September 2024.
Then, Homan, who was director of the Immigration and Customs Control Service (ICE) in Trump’s first mandatehe was not an official and was a candidate to occupy a high position in immigration in the event that the Republican won the presidential ones in November, as finally happened.
Homanly, he accepted the agents’ money, who made them pass by businessmen who offered him the amount in exchange for obtaining contracts related to the hardening of immigration laws, something that Trump had already said that he would do, details the newspaper.
The Washington Post ensures that the Department of Justice initiated an investigation for bribery against homan in the last months of the Joe Biden administration and that the government of his successor closed this year alleging lack of credible evidence and qualifying it as “political research.”
In any case, there are doubts about the possibility that Homin could be processed, since at the time of the alleged bribery he did not occupy any government position.
The investigation, released for the first time by the MSNBC chainarose following an investigation around an entrepreneur linked to border security, who was allegedly referred to the agents to Homin to obtain contracts.
Homan has headed together with the current Secretary of National Security, Kristi Noem, the crusade against illegal immigration that has marked the return to the power of Donald Trump, which in his eight months of mandate has deported more than 200,000 people, according to government data.
